Chemistry Check: Beyond Physical Attraction

When you’re exploring hookup sites, physical attraction often comes first—but compatibility matters if you want interactions that feel good for both people. Start by pausing for a quick chemistry check: ask about expectations, be honest about yours, and listen to how the other person answers.

Key areas to explore

  • Relationship goals: Are you both looking for casual encounters, friends-with-benefits, or something that could become more? Clarifying this early prevents mixed signals.
  • Values and boundaries: Talk about what’s important to you—safety practices, discretion, privacy, and emotional boundaries. Respecting limits is a sign of real compatibility.
  • Lifestyle fit: Consider schedules, openness to meeting at certain places, travel tolerance, and how social life or work might affect availability.
  • Communication style: Notice whether they prefer direct talk, playful banter, or slower check-ins. Agree on how to raise concerns and how often to check in after encounters.
  • Health and safety: Share expectations about sexual health, testing, and safer-sex practices in a straightforward, nonjudgmental way.

Practical questions to ask early

  1. “What are you hoping to get out of connecting right now?”
  2. “How do you feel about keeping things casual versus seeing where it goes?”
  3. “Are there any boundaries or dealbreakers I should know about?”
  4. “What makes a meetup feel respectful and comfortable for you?”
  5. “How do you like to communicate before and after we meet?”

Conversation tips

  • Frame questions as mutual—use “we” and “us” to signal collaboration rather than interrogation.
  • Be direct but kind; blunt honesty avoids confusion, and empathy keeps things safe and consensual.
  • Listen for consistency between words and behavior; someone’s actions (timing, follow-through) often reveal more than promises.

Doing this chemistry check doesn’t mean the mood needs to dry up—approach it as clear, caring communication that makes encounters better for everyone. When both people know the plan, respect limits, and share expectations, casual connections can be enjoyable and mutually respectful.

Dating Confidence Reset: Clear Intentions, Calm Pace, Realistic Expectations

Start by clarifying what you want from dating right now. Do you want casual conversation, new friends, or someone to explore a relationship with? Write down one clear goal and a single boundary you won’t compromise—this makes decisions faster and reduces second-guessing.

Slow Down Conversations

Match quality matters more than quantity. Let conversations develop at a steady pace: ask a thoughtful question, share a brief personal detail, and wait for a real response before escalating. If replies feel rushed or inconsistent, pause and reassess rather than pushing to force a connection.

Keep Expectations Realistic

Remember that most first chats won’t turn into something serious—and that’s normal. Treat each exchange as useful practice: you learn what you like, what you don’t, and how to communicate. Avoid the numbers-game mindset of swiping endlessly; instead, choose a few profiles that genuinely interest you and give them attention.

Notice Small Wins

Track quiet progress to stay motivated: a clearer profile photo, a message that led to a real conversation, or a boundary you honored. Celebrate these small wins—they are signs you’re improving your dating skills and protecting your energy.

Protect Emotional Steadiness

  • Set simple limits: a daily time cap for the app, or one message thread to prioritize each evening.
  • Take breaks when you feel fatigued—stepping away is a strategy, not a failure.
  • Use neutral language in profiles and messages to reduce pressure and invite honest responses.

Choose Matches Thoughtfully

Scan profiles for signs of shared values or compatible rhythms (availability, communication style, life stage). If someone’s profile or messages consistently clash with your boundary, move on without explanation. Respecting your standards helps attract people who will respect them too.
